No parent should have to leave hospital without the essentials for their newborn.

A new partnership between Baby Bank Network Bristol and Southmead Hospital is helping families in crisis by providing emergency newborn bundles with clothing, nappies and toiletries. North Bristol NHS Trust

The initiative ensures babies can go home safely – and parents can access further support once they leave hospital.

🚍 Free bus travel is helping thousands of children get out and explore the West of England.

New figures show that in some Bristol neighbourhoods the number of kids using buses more than doubled last summer thanks to the Kids Go Free scheme.

Nearly 1.1 million free journeys were taken in just nine weeks – saving families around £1.1 million.

With Easter approaching, many parents will be hoping the scheme returns again soon.
